Choose the Right Insulation for Each Area

Other types of insulation may benefit different areas of your home. Spray foam is excellent for attics and crawl spaces because it provides a strong seal, while fiberglass can work well on walls and floors. Assessing the unique needs of each space ensures effective insulation.

Seal Air Leaks

Sealing air leaks is one of the easiest and most effective insulation tips. Drafts around windows, doors, and in the attic can increase energy consumption. Use caulk or spray foam to seal these gaps, preventing heat loss in winter and keeping cool air inside during summer.

Maintain Proper Ventilation

While insulation is critical to retaining indoor temperatures, proper ventilation is also essential. In areas like the attic, ventilation prevents moisture buildup and improves air quality. Ensure your attic has vents allowing air to flow freely, reducing the risk of mold and other issues.
